    SUMMARY:
    - About 20 minutes before you take off, you’ll hear two high-pitched dings in a row over the intercom system. This only means that one crew member wants to talk to another, just to get into preparation mode for the flight.
    - 15 minutes before your plane takes off, you’ll hear a single ding. This is a call from the cockpit to the flight attendants to pick up the phone.
    - 10 minutes before take-off: you’ll hear a soft pound from under the plane, and a drill-like sound. This is just the crew closing and securing the cargo hold.
    - Love it or hate it, there’s nothing quite like feeling your plane leave the ground! You’ll hear the sound of the plane’s wheels going back up into its belly.
    - 5 minutes after take-off two loud beeps will go off. This is the pilot telling the flight attendants that the plane has reached a certain altitude.
    - If there’s a lot of turbulence, the pilot may send a ding over the intercom system, warning flight attendants that it might get a little bumpy.
    - When the plane has reached a certain cruising altitude and you’ve been flying for a while, it’s safe to take your seatbelt off and move around!
    - Just like there were two dings when you reached a certain height after take-off, the two dings will ring again when you’ve reached that same level on your descent.
    - A bump and deep thunk 2 minutes before landing mean the airplane’s landing gear is coming out, which includes the wheels and anything else in the plane’s undercarriage that helps it land.
    - The wheels will touch down on the runway, and you may feel and hear some bumps or thuds.
    - Bumps during a landing are totally normal, even expected. You’ll cruise along the runway for a while, so that you can slow down.

  • @jasminejohnston6393
    @jasminejohnston6393 4 ปีที่แล้ว +2

    My favourite sound to hear on board a plane is that humming sound when you first board the plane. This is coming from the plane’s auxiliary power unit, or APU, which is a generator near the plane’s tail that provides power before the pilot starts up the engines. The APU also helps the engines start up by providing an electric jolt

  • @J.Beetle
    @J.Beetle 4 ปีที่แล้ว

    This focuses a lot on cabin chimes. Almost everybody knows it is normal. But you haven even mentioned the thuds when the bags are being loaded, you also didn't mention the famous "dog bark" generated by the PTUs, the metal contact between the tow truck and nose wheel during pushback, the silence when engines are about to start and air-conditioning system is temporarily shut down (some people are afraid of that too), the bass drop during engine start, the occasional metal clankings caused by the steering or braking and the engine grinding sound during take-off power. These are some of the actual noises that people are actually afraid of. Not the chimes that you kept repeating.
